Cheboygan Area Trail Report – 12/04

TRAILS UPDATE: HUGE shout out to our dedicated volunteers. They have been working since Monday morning clearing trees.

Unfortunately, temps and the variation of snow depths we haven’t been able to get the tractors out.

This is currently early season conditions, ride with EXTREME caution.

Trail Updates:
Trail 9 Mac City to Cheboygan to Mann Rd. This trail has been cleared of more than 70 downed trees. It does have rideable snow. Gets light in patches in Mac City but it is open.

Trail 720: Cheboygan to Long Pointe Rd: This trail had over 30 trees down and snow gets lighter the further south. There are patches of zero snow due to the wind.

Trail 99: Cheboygan to Black mountain. This is currently not accessible from Cheboygan. The private property you have to ride through is underwater and we are gonna need a few nights of hard freezes to make it solid. We have been told there is riding to be had out at black mountain but it is not advised to go through town to get there.

Wish I had better news but hey I am glad to be giving some report this early in the season. Looking like this weekend is gonna be a wild card with Sunday looking at 39 and rain.

Lake Gogebic Trail Report – 12/04

LAKE GOGEBIC AREA UPDATE via Gogebic Area Grooming​ – 12/4

We got all our equipment in yesterday including our new Pistenbully. We will be working on getting everything up and running today. We had one groomer out yesterday up 102. Beware of the water holes! We are trying to freeze them up as fast as possible so we can pass through them. So dust those sleds off and get ready to ride some awesome trails this year. We’ll keep you posted on updates and dangerous areas that we find.
